αἰθήρ : the upper air, or sky, aether; αἰθέρι ναίων, of Zeus, dweller in the heavens; more exactly conceived as having οὐρανός beyond it, Il. 2.458; separated from the lower α?ήρ by the clouds, as Hera in Il. 15.20 swings ἐν αἰθέρι καὶ νεφέλῃσιν.
